About Professor Ford’s research      

Professor Caroline Ford and her team are investigating new approaches to both treatment and early detection of ovarian cancer. Until December 2025, Professor Ford lead the Gynaecological Cancer Research Group at the University of New South Wales (UNSW). The lab investigated a targeted treatment for high-grade serous ovarian cancer that focuses on a receptor called ROR1 that sits on the surface of cancer cells. Additionally, alongside Dr Kristina Warton, the lab undertook early detection research focused on methylation (or marks on DNA that regulate how genes are switched on and off), to identify patterns that could help detect ovarian cancers at the earliest stages in blood samples. OCRF funding provided crucial support to Professor Ford’s lab between 2013 and 2020. Professor Ford is now the Strategic Director of the Ainsworth Endometriosis Research Institute, however her former team's research into ovarian cancer early detection continues under the leadership of Dr Kristina Warton.

Background

Professor Ford was initially intrigued by contagious diseases — she grew up captivated by movies like ‘Outbreak’, which featured an inspiring female scientist played by Rene Russo. Professor Ford went on to complete her honours in cancer research and virology and found she enjoyed the dynamic hospital space where samples were being tested at pace and there was the potential of making an immediate difference to a patient. 

As cancer research became a key interest, Professor Ford built upon her knowledge through two postdoctoral projects at the University of Toronto in Canada and Lund University in Sweden. During her postdoctoral studies her research focused on lung and breast cancers. A government-funded National Health and Medical Research Council fellowship tempted her back to Australia in 2009 and she established her lab at the UNSW’s Lowy Cancer Research Centre in Sydney in 2010. She was able to choose the focus of her lab: gynaecological cancers.  

As a feminist, Professor Ford was already aware of the disparities in resources and research focus on gynaecological cancers, such as ovarian cancer. A clinician outlined the specific knowledge gaps in ovarian cancer and, with an early career grant from Cure Cancer Australia, she launched her first ovarian cancer research project, investigating the Wnt signalling pathway that is key for cancer function. 

Career highlights  

Two factors have been essential to building the lab’s successes: 

Connecting to the clinic: While establishing the lab, Professor Ford asked to attend clinical meetings at the Royal Hospital for Women in NSW, led by Professor Neville Hacker. Attendees all had different expertise, and the meetings brought them together to focus on an individual’s treatment. These multidisciplinary meetings didn’t always include researchers, but Professor Ford insisted it was essential for identifying the most impactful areas for new research. She listened and learnt about the challenges faced by clinicians and their patients, identifying patterns. As a scientist of precision medicine and genomics, who had seen this type of research improve outcomes in other cancers, her eyes were opened to the urgent need for better options for ovarian cancers, and the need for her lab to focus on work that would translate to the clinic quickly.  

Connecting to the community: By working with members of the ovarian cancer community in her research, she’s developed decade-long relationships that have been transformative for ensuring the relevance of her research to those it impacts most, with an emphasis on quality of life and care.  

Professor Ford’s and her team’s objectives continue to be centred on translating research to the clinic, with continuous insights from the ovarian cancer community driving the work.  


Collaborative impact

Professor Ford has prioritised international and local collaborations to ensure she is working with the best of the best to expedite solutions for the community. During her OCRF-funded research the team developed a partnership with a research group at The University of Chicago, who helped develop a new type of lab model that would help Professor Ford later establish the relevance of ROR1 as an ovarian cancer treatment target. To test this treatment in clinically relevant models, her team worked with researchers from The Walter Hall and Eliza Institute of Medical Research in Melbourne, to create diverse laboratory models for thorough testing, which yielded promising published results.
